- The distance between Aranyaprathet, Thailand and Santiago, Dominican Republic is approximately 16,256 km or 10,102 mi.
- To reach Aranyaprathet in this distance one would set out from Santiago bearing 11.9°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Aranyaprathet bearing 168.4° or SSE .
- Both have a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Aranyaprathet is in or near the tropical dry forest biome whereas Santiago is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 1.6 °C (2.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 0.7 °C (1.3°F) more in Aranyaprathet.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 414.3 mm (16.3 in) more which is equivalent to 414.3 l/m² (10.17 US gal/ft²) or 4,143,000 l/ha (442,914 US gal/ac) more. About 1 2/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 2.9° higher in Aranyaprathet than in Santiago.
